Which of the following is an example of the second step, Assess Hazards, in the 5-step Risk Management Process?

A) Determining the probability and severity of a DUI-caused accident before going to a bar
B) Getting feedback on warning signs posted on a bulletin board
C) Posting an updated safety notice on the department bulletin board when a new procedure is approved
D) Considering having a designated driver after a few alcoholic drinks

Sagot :

Final answer:

Assess Hazards is the second step in risk management, exemplified by evaluating the likelihood of a DUI-caused accident before bar visit.


Explanation:

Assess Hazards is the second step in the 5-step Risk Management Process. An example of this step is Determining the probability and severity of a DUI-caused accident before going to a bar. This step involves identifying potential dangers and assessing the likelihood of adverse outcomes.
